PERMANENT FULL-TIME POSITION IN NORTH VANCOUVER (Onsite)

CLOSES: Open Until Filled

Be Part of Something Meaningful!

Do you have a passion for education, advocacy, and uplifting Indigenous learners? The Squamish Nation’s Ta7lnew̓ás Education Department is hiring a Post-Secondary School Advocate to support the success and empowerment of Squamish students pursuing certificate, diploma, and degree programs. This role centers on meaningful engagement, mentorship, and community relationships. You’ll walk beside learners on their journey, providing culturally grounded support that empowers academic achievement and celebrates Squamish identity and potential.

What You’ll Do

  • Advocate for Squamish Nation post-secondary students, supporting them from planning through graduation.
  • Help students explore career and education options, assess academic readiness, and navigate application processes.
  • Provide ongoing academic advising, mentorship access, and tutoring coordination.
  • Support high school outreach in the Squamish Valley 2–3 times per year to promote post-secondary pathways.
  • Administer and manage the Squamish Nation Post-Secondary Program, including student funding allocations and compliance with our Post-Secondary Education Program Policy and Procedure Handbook.
  • Monitor student progress, offering personalized support to enhance retention and graduation outcomes.
  • Collaborate with post-secondary institutions and serve on relevant committees to ensure supportive learning environments for Squamish students.
  • Maintain detailed student records and prepare reports for planning and program evaluation.
  • Contribute to continuous improvement and innovation within the Education, Employment & Training team.

What We’re Looking For

  • A diploma or degree in Education, Social Work, Indigenous Studies, Business, Career Counselling or a related field.
  • Experience working with First Nations learners, especially in post-secondary or youth mentoring environments.
  • Knowledge of Indigenous education policies and barriers impacting access and success.
  • Demonstrated understanding of Squamish Nation values, language, and educational priorities.
  • Strong interpersonal, communication, and motivational skills.
  • Comfort working with data, budgets, and program reporting.
  • Excellent time management, organization, and problem-solving ability.
  • Respect for confidentiality and ethical student support practices.
  • A valid BC Driver’s License (Class 5) and ability to travel between North Vancouver and Squamish Valley.
  • Commitment to cultural awareness and respect for Sḵwx̱wú7mesh Úxwumixw values, language, and traditions.
